涉及到将WPF应用程序中的数据网格(DataGrid)导出到Excel文件时出现的编码问题。在导出过程中,可能会遇到乱码、格式错误或特殊字符显示异常等问题。
为解决这个问题,可以采取以下步骤:
- 确定数据编码格式:首先需要确定数据的编码格式,常见的编码格式包括UTF-8、GBK等。根据数据的实际情况选择合适的编码格式。
- 设置Excel文件编码格式:在导出数据到Excel文件之前,需要设置Excel文件的编码格式与数据编码一致。可以使用相关库或工具来实现,例如使用NPOI、EPPlus等库。
- 数据转换和编码处理:在导出数据之前,对数据进行适当的转换和编码处理,确保数据能够正确显示。例如,如果数据中包含特殊字符或非ASCII字符,可以使用编码转换方法将其转换为合适的字符编码。
- 文件格式设置:在导出数据到Excel文件时,需要设置合适的文件格式,例如使用XLS、XLSX等格式。不同格式的Excel文件对编码的支持可能有所差异,根据实际情况选择合适的文件格式。
- 推荐腾讯云相关产品:腾讯云提供了一系列云计算相关产品,包括云服务器、云数据库、云存储等。在处理云计算中的编码问题时,可以使用腾讯云的相关产品来存储和处理数据,确保数据的安全和可靠性。
需要注意的是,以上提供的方法和推荐的腾讯云产品仅供参考,具体应根据实际情况选择合适的解决方案。同时,在解决编码问题时,需要根据具体的技术要求和业务需求进行相应的调整和优化。